Fundraising opportunity of the Barack bounce and similar events?

I've met a lot of happy people here this morning following the US election result last night, which makes me wonder if anyone has tried timing a fundraising appeal to coincide with these occasional feel-good events?

Is there any research to show that fundraising appeals that arrive the day after an event like a political landslide, zeitgeist change, or perhaps even a country's major sporting victory enjoy any particular success?

I imagine it would have been difficult to time such an appeal in the pre-Internet age, even if one could see it coming a day or so beforehand, like the Labour election landslide of 1997. But now we can get appeals out via our digital networks in minutes, perhaps this is another fundraising opportunity for us?

Anyone trying an appeal today to try to capture this surge of optimism?

And yes, I realise there are lots of people who won't be feeling too happy this morning, and others who will not have any interest in the election result.
